| Re-Leased | Legacy | Re-Leased | Real Estate Property Management | ERP Services and Operations | n/a | 2023 | 2023 | In 2023 Activityplex Canada implemented Re-Leased as its Real Estate Property Management platform to centralize commercial property management for multiple family activity centres in Ontario, Canada. The deployment positioned Re-Leased to serve tenancy records, tenant profiles, calendar-driven lease events, and consolidated reporting across the organization. Re-Leased was configured to maintain tenant profiles and tenancy records, and to surface a calendar dashboard for key dates such as renewals and rent schedules. Consolidated reporting capabilities were implemented to unify occupancy and lease data for operational planning and routine administration. The implementation included an explicit Xero accounting integration, linking tenancy and invoicing data from Re-Leased into the company accounting ledger. Operational coverage focused on site-level property administration and finance workflows, aligning property management and accounting functions for the Activityplex Canada team. Governance centered on using Re-Leased to reduce manual tasks and to scale operations more efficiently, with calendar dashboards and consolidated reports improving visibility into lease events and tenant activity. The system is used as the primary Real Estate Property Management application for ongoing tenancy administration and financial coordination. |
